Amber Fort
Immerse yourself in the regal splendor of Amber Fort, perched atop the Aravalli hills in Jaipur. This majestic fortress blends stunning Rajput architecture with breathtaking panoramic vistas of lush greenery, ancient walls, and serene water bodies. Feel the echo of centuries-old legends as you wander its ornate courtyards and ramparts under the brilliant midday sun, surrounded by the vibrant energy of pilgrims, tourists, and local life. Amber Fort invites every traveler to experience a magical journey through time and culture beneath a clear blue sky.

The nearest airport is Jaipur International Airport (JAI), approximately 30 minutes by car from Amber Fort.
Stay at heritage hotels, boutique guesthouses, or luxury resorts in Jaipur city center near Amber Fort.
Combine your visit with trips to City Palace, Jal Mahal, Hawa Mahal, or a cultural walk through Jaipur's old city markets.
